This is done as part of Lesson 1. ? debugger-lesson01.zip through debugger-lesson07.zip – zip files for the 7 lessons in the tutorial Sample Java Application – Personal Lending Library This is a small sample application to track our personal library of books. It includes a list of people to whom we loan our books. The application has four Java classes: 1. Person has fields for the person's name and a number which will be the maximum number of books this person can borrow at one time. 2. Book has fields for title, author, and the person who is currently borrowing the book. 3. MyLibrary contains a list of all of our books and a list of all of the people who might borrow them. It includes methods for checking books out to people and checking them back in. It also includes a main() method that simulates a user session. In the main() method, a new MyLibrary is created, books and people are created and added to it, and some books are checked out and check in.   • With the rise of model-driven development, model repositories are intended to facilitate research in model engineering and consequently in domain-specific modeling. Model repositories are central places where all kinds of modeling artifacts (e.g., meta-metamodels, metamodels, models, and possibly transformation models) are stored and coordinated. They can serve as a platform for making available the specification of metamodels to others (typically necessary for domain-specific modeling languages) and for exchanging models, as well as a resource for teaching/learning materials. There have been started some intiatives for building model repositories, e.g., zoomm.org, www.kermeta.org/mrep, or the Atlas MegaModel Management (AM3) [1]. The latter one is hosted within the popular Eclipse environment and is a subproject of the Generative Modeling Technologies (GMT) project. The artifacts present in this model repository, furthermore, are organized into sets of models of similar nature called zoos, e.g. a zoo for metamodels and a zoo for transformations [4]. The AM3 zoos are continuously growing and provide a respectable source of information in the meantime. However, a more popular way of storing and organizing modeling artifacts is probably having a CVS like server software at hand. These repositories provide all means necessary to handle different versions of textual artifacts and let them compare syntactically. It seams therefore obvious to use existing tools also to store models as they can be serialized into the XMI format.   • What is Service Express? Service Express is American Honda’s Web-based system for delivering electronic service publications to the aftermarket. In Service Express, technicians have access to the same service information available to Honda and Acura dealers: Service Manuals, Service Bulletins, ServiceNews, Wiring Diagrams, Body Repair Manuals, Accessory Installation Instructions, Owners Manuals, and the Parts Catalogs in one convenient place. When you use Service Express, you get the latest parts and service information available, and you can search across many types of publications simultaneously. How does it work? You search in Service Express by selecting the Model and Year of the vehicle you’re working on, then choose a subject or enter a keyword. Service Express will retrieve all service information related to the subject or keyword to help you repair the vehicle. NOTE: We continually update Service Express, so a printed copy of the Service Express QuickStart may not exactly match what you see on your computer screen. This isn’t usually a problem, because the basic Service Express searching and navigation procedures do not change. Download PDF

Summary Affected Products Details Impact Software Veio and Fixes Workarounds Obtaining Fixed Software Exploitation and Public Announcements Status of This Notice: FINAL Distribution Revision History Cisco Security Procedures Summary The Cisco Secure PIX Firewall AAA authentication feature, introduced in veion 4.0, is vulnerable to a Denial of Service (DoS) attack initiated by authenticating use on the system. This vulnerability affects specific configuratio and has been resolved in released veio of the PIX Firewall. This vulnerability has been assigned Cisco bug ID CSCdt92339. The complete notice will be available at http://www.cisco.com/warp/public/707/cisco?sa?20011003?pix?firewall?auth?flood.shtml. Affected Products This section provides details on affected products. Vulnerable Products All use of Cisco Secure PIX Firewalls with software veio 4.0 up to and including 4.4(8), 5.0(3), 5.1(3), 5.2(2), and 5.3(1) with configuratio using AAA authentication are at risk.   • Fortran is the most widely used programming language in the world for numerical applications. It has achieved this position partly by being on the scene earlier than any of the other major languages and partly because it seems gradually to have evolved the features which its users, especially scientists and engineers, found most useful. In order to retain compatibility with old programs, Fortran has advanced mainly by adding new features rather than by removing old ones. The net result is, of course, that some parts of the language are, by present standards, rather archaic: some of these can be avoided easily, others can still be a nuisance. This section gives a brief history of the language, outlines its future prospects, and summarises its strengths and weaknesses. Fortran was invented by a team of programmers working for IBM in the early nineteen-fifties. This group, led by John Backus, produced the first compiler, for an IBM 704 computer, in 1957. They used the name Fortran because one of their principal aims was “formula translation”. But Fortran was in fact one of the very first high-level language: it came complete with control structures and facilities for input/output. Fortran became popular quite rapidly and compilers were soon produced for other IBM machines. Before long other manufacturers were forced to design Fortran compilers for their own hardware.
